Webb4.5 Your Program’s Working Directory. Each time you start your program with run, the inferior will be initialized with the current working directory specified by the set cwd command. If no directory has been specified by this command, then the inferior will inherit GDB’s current working directory as its working directory if native debugging, or it will … Webb23 okt. 2024 · Example. WebbWhen no target selection options are given, cargo run will run the binary target. If there are multiple binary targets, you must pass a target flag to choose one. Or, the default-run field may be specified in the [package] section of Cargo.toml to choose the name of the binary to run by default. --bin name. Run the specified binary. The docker run command first creates a writeable container layer over the specified image, and then starts it using the specified command. That is, docker run is equivalent to the API /containers/create then /containers/ (id)/start.
